- The distance between Nairobi, Kenya and Siemreap, Cambodia is approximately 7,571 km or 4,705 mi.
- To reach Nairobi in this distance one would set out from Siemreap bearing 263.1°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Nairobi bearing 255° or WSW .
- Nairobi has a subtropical highland climate with no dry season (Cfb) whereas Siemreap has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Nairobi is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Siemreap is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 8.9 °C (16.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.5 °C (2.7°F) less in Nairobi.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 356 mm (14 in) less which is equivalent to 356 l/m² (8.74 US gal/ft²) or 3,560,000 l/ha (380,588 US gal/ac) less. About 5/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.2° higher in Nairobi than in Siemreap.
- Relative humidity levels are 6.5%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 10°C (18°F) lower.
